The Philadelphia Eagles traded running back Wilbert Montgomery to the Detroit Lions for free agent linebacker Garry Cobb.
The trade was made possible because Cobb, 28, came to terms with the Eagles and Montgomery, 30, passed the Lions’ physical. Montgomery was a training-camp holdout and had recurring knee problems.
